Output 58d990057cf18d2df672f0d2a9a7c5a1cfbe356c84f16cf15119e3e74163e000:0

value
1393969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16deb31223e558faf946e943d7d4cc78f0104a80 OP_EQUAL
address
33mwaCLQfivMizdyG7nVueSLTA6mJeHDpu
transaction
58d990057cf18d2df672f0d2a9a7c5a1cfbe356c84f16cf15119e3e74163e000
spent
true